When is the Best Time to Ask for a Review for Your Online Store?

Image
    Gaining customer trust is the lifeline of any online store, and reviews play a critical role in building that trust. But let’s face it—getting customers to leave reviews can be a challenge. With so many distractions and busy schedules, how do you make sure they take the time to share their feedback? The secret lies in timing. Yes, there’s a perfect moment to ask for reviews, and doing so can transform satisfied customers into your biggest advocates. If you’re struggling to collect reviews, this guide will show you exactly when and how to ask for them to maximize your results. Key Takeaways from the Article 1️⃣ Immediately After Purchase Strike while the iron is hot! A quick thank-you email with a polite request for a review ensures you catch your customer when they’re most engaged. 2️⃣ After Product Delivery Allow customers some time to experience the product, then follow up within 3–7 days.   Running a WooCommerce store is rewarding, but handling returns can be tricky without a clear and effective return policy. A well-crafted policy not only resolves disputes but also enhances customer trust, satisfaction, and loyalty. Here’s a quick guide to help you draft a return policy that works for your business. What is a Return Policy? A return policy outlines the conditions under which customers can return products for a refund, replacement, or exchange. It includes time limits, product conditions, and shipping cost responsibilities. For example, some stores allow returns within 30 days for unused items in original packaging, while excluding custom or final-sale items. Why Your WooCommerce Store Needs a Return Policy Builds Trust: A clear policy reassures customers about their purchases, reducing hesitation and fostering loyalty.
